## Deploying the Gatewick Proctor Queue

Deploys are pretty painless: push to main, wait for the pipeline, then watch the queue drain dashboard for five minutes. If candidates pile up mid-exam, roll back first and ask questions later — the queue replays safely. Everything the workers care about lives in one config block, shown here for reference.

settings of bafof-yagef:
JOROX_PIN=8740
JOROX_TENANT=pelox
JOROX_METRICS_HOST=metrics.jorox.qorvelworks.internal
JOROX_SEAL=seal_c78f63c1
JOROX_STANDBY_TEAM=norax

Ticket #4821: While auditing feature parity between the Kestrelwave Java and Python SDKs, we found the shared staging credential expired last Tuesday, blocking the parity test harness. Both SDKs must exercise the batch-upload endpoint identically before sign-off. A replacement credential has been provisioned with read-only scope, per security policy. For the reviewer's verification, the new key for the parity service follows.

gateway credential: kto3_qfe

## Onboarding — Retiring the Homegrown Queue

We are replacing Pebblecart's homegrown job queue (the `taskbelt` tables) with a managed broker. During the transition, both systems run side by side: new producers publish to the broker, while legacy workers drain remaining `taskbelt` rows. New team members should never enqueue into `taskbelt` directly. To inspect the legacy backlog during the drain, connect with this string:

primary connection of yagep-kahip = redis://giliel_svc:zYiKsLL2PLpfPL@db-348f.xolmarsys.corp:5432/fenwyn

Alert: UndoStackDesync fired in Plotweave, our diagram editor. After a redo following a shape-group operation, the undo stack can reference deleted node IDs, producing a blank canvas on the next undo. Frequency is low but user-visible, and the 4.2 release candidate includes the grouping change that triggers it. Recommend holding the release until the stack-rebuild patch from the Canvas team is merged and verified. The triage notes and reproduction steps are on the page below.

wiki page, bagaf-fawip: https://harbor.tolvaqsys.local/pages/repo/pages/secrets/eac969ffc71f356b